On June 10, 2026, the Cleveland Guardians were swept by the New York Yankees at Progressive Field. This marks the end of a streak that had not seen the Guardians swept by an opponent for a long time. Guardians manager Stephen Vogt acknowledged the competitive nature of the series, citing that the team had opportunities to win despite the sweep. Cleveland lost the first game by two runs in extra innings and the second game after a late home run by Jazz Chisholm. Vogt remained optimistic about the experience and expressed hope that the team would learn from these closely contested games moving forward.
- •Guardians lost all three games in the series against Yankees.
- •First game ended in extra innings; Guardians lost by two runs.
- •Jazz Chisholm hit a decisive home run in the second game.
- •Guardians struggled with runners in scoring position, hitting 2-for-21 in the series.
- •Manager Vogt emphasized lessons to be learned from close games.
